Switching in to the dependant route

This page explains the circumstances in which you can apply for permission to stay here as the dependant of someone who is already here in the high-value migrant category (Tier 1 General) without having to leave the United Kingdom and apply for a visa.

How you can switch in to the dependant route

You can apply for permission to stay here as the dependant of a migrant under Tier 1 (General), without having to leave the United Kingdom and apply for a visa if:

  • your last visa to enter the United Kingdom or permission to stay here was as the partner or child of a person who has valid permission to enter or stay here as a migrant under Tier 1 (General), or who is at the same time being granted permission to enter or stay here as a migrant under Tier 1 (General) or;
  • you are a child born in the United Kingdom to a migrant under Tier 1 (General) and their dependant partner.
